O.K. So What Do You Think Of The Micarta
After an unconscionable wait for the pen, (ten days! by combined FedEx and USPS ((I've heard they've changed shipping methods)) it arrived today and I put it right to work. I filled it with Noodler's Brown and have been writing in my various journals and have written a letter. The truth is a have some pens that I love, Edison's, Pilot's, the Lamy 2000, a couple of Bexley's, but I can't remember a pen that felt so absolutely made for me. The feel of the micarta is just fantastic.The photos don't do it justice and are going to discourage some people. That's a shame. The weight and shape of the pen are pure perfection and the medium nib writes as smoothly as everything save perhaps my Pelikan. I am very happy with this pen.

I am loving my Micarta. I had originally ordered a clipless version but was accidentally sent a Clipped version. Phillip offered to correct the issue but the only reason I ordered the clipless in the first place was that I was affriad ink might leak out of the hole the clip vanishes into since there is no inner cap. Phillip assured me that wouldn't be a problem so I decided to keep the clipped version. I am glad I did! Using a simple blow test into the cap, virtually no air leaks out so I'm confident the clip will not be a problem for me personally. I do like the way the clip complements the design of the Micarta. I can't wait to see how it ages.
As far as nibs go, the Micarta has a #6 nib where as the 530/540 has a #5. The feed is diffrent as well so the 540 nibs will NOT fit onto the Micarta, there may be a way to get it to fit but I don't know of it. Mine has a Fine nib and I like it, it writes more like a medium however. I'll be getting a stub whenever they come out and I hope they are as stiff as this nib!
Overall, I like the Micarta better then the 540. It's earned a spot in my daily carry next to my Edison's and 540.
Edit - I did see on another forum that someone was able to remove the Twsbi nib and put a Danitrio nib on the pen. I think it worked because the Dani was a #6 nib as well. They knocked the Twsbi nib out and slid the Dani in and now they have a 14K flex nib on their Micarta!
